// REINDEX_BATCH_CAP limits docs per shard pass in the Tallowfield
// nightly search reindex. Raising it starves the ingest queue;
// lowering it overruns the maintenance window. 5000 is the tested
// sweet spot. Change only with a soak run. Verified against the
// build noted below.

session token of bawif-hahog = htk6_ac5981

# Quillbridge Environments

## Webhook Retry Semantics

Reviewers checking delivery code should note that retry behavior differs per environment. Staging retries aggressively with short backoff to surface flaky endpoints early; production uses exponential backoff with jitter and a dead-letter queue after the final attempt. Duplicate delivery is possible, so handlers must be idempotent. Each environment's dispatcher reads its limits at boot. Production currently runs with the following values.

settings of yageg-yahap:
[gorael]
team = olieth
access_code = ac_941d74
owner = brieth.aldiel
host = gorael.tolvaqio.internal
port = 6379
peer = briwyn.urlaqtech.internal
salt = 116e6622
pin = 1957

Minutes — Management Meeting (Sales Leads)

Topic: Q3 Budget Request

Denna presented the ask: extra headcount for the Larkspur accounts and a bump to the travel line. Finance pushed back a bit on the events spend, so we trimmed it. Revised figures go to Orvan by Friday. Sales leads should hold commitments until sign-off. The thinking behind the reallocation is set out below.

internal memo for haduf-fajeg: Headcount on the Quenwyn team goes from 7 to 80 by the end of July. Gross margin on Quenwyn came in at 10 percent against a plan of 15 percent.

Ticket: FARECALC-health — config drift on Tollgate rules engine.

New folks: Tollgate computes shipping fees from zone rules. Staging and prod diverged last month after a manual hotfix; fee tiers no longer match the declared manifest. Do not hand-edit nodes. Re-sync from the manifest, redeploy, verify with the smoke suite. Drift detector now runs hourly and pages on mismatch. The canonical values that every environment must converge to are reproduced below.

config for yadug-kahip:
[kelys]
host = kelys.torvahq.local
user = kelys_svc
database = kelys_prod